Septic tanks...?

We just moved into a house that has a septic tank. I dont know what size the tank is. Can anyone give a rough estimate on how much it would cost to have it emptied?

Answers:
To get a septic tank emptied it is usually around 100.00 more or less. 60.00 to 150.00. The tanks are usually about 1,000 gals.

An average septic tank in Michigan can be pumped for about $70. The septic guy will come out and tell you if it is needed.
Try not to put too many poisons, grease, bleach etc. A septic field is a living system which you can kill.
3 bed room tank is mostly 900 gal.....here in nc we get them pumped for $ 175.00...ur area might be different....
